Pasta Ingredients:
400g of white (or a mix of white and whole wheat) flour
3/4 teaspoon of salt
4 eggs
Mix ingredients in a bowl, and knead until uniform. Cook this kind of pasta for 3 - 5 minutes in boiling water.
